Nioro vs Port Jervis, Ny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Nioro, Mali and Port Jervis, Ny, Usa is approximately 6,871 km or 4,270 mi.
  • To reach Nioro in this distance one would set out from Port Jervis, Ny bearing 94.1° or E and follow the great circles arc to approach Nioro bearing 128.7° or SE .
  • Nioro has a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h) whereas Port Jervis, Ny has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a).
  • Nioro is in or near the tropical very dry forest biome whereas Port Jervis, Ny is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 18.6 °C (33.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 15.1 °C (27.2°F) less in Nioro.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 638.9 mm (25.2 in) less which is equivalent to 638.9 l/m² (15.68 US gal/ft²) or 6,389,000 l/ha (683,027 US gal/ac) less. About 3/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 22.7° higher in Nioro than in Port Jervis, Ny.
